What is a 10DLC?
A 10DLC (10-digit long code) is a type of local phone number that you can register to send A2P (Application-to-Person) SMS and MMS messages to people in the United States and Canada. 10DLCs are authorised by mobile carriers for business messaging, helping you reach your audience reliably and compliantly.
10DLCs use the same 10-digit format as regular mobile numbers, making them familiar and trustworthy to recipients. They are only usable for messaging within North America (specifically the USA and Canada).
Why choose a 10DLC?
Better deliverability: Messages sent via 10DLCs are less likely to be filtered or blocked compared to standard long codes.
More affordable: 10DLCs are generally cheaper than dedicated short codes while still offering good performance.
Carrier compliance: 10DLCs meet US and Canadian mobile carrier regulations for business messaging.
What is a 10DLC campaign?
A campaign explains the type of messages you plan to send (for example, customer support updates or promotions) and provides a few sample messages.
If you plan to send using a 10DLC in the US, you must register a campaign. Campaigns are not required in Canada.
US carriers require campaigns to make sure messaging is clear and legitimate. Every 10DLC must be linked to an approved campaign.
Giving clear, accurate information when registering helps you get faster approval and better messaging speeds.
Can overseas businesses use 10DLCs?
Yes. While 10DLCs are for sending messages to recipients in the United States and Canada, you can register and use them if your business is based in an eligible country outside North America.
